标签: 形式化方法

  • 深入学习:Coursera上的《Automated Reasoning: Symbolic Model Checking》课程推荐

    课程链接: https://www.coursera.org/learn/automated-reasoning-symbolic-model-checking

    近年来,自动推理和模型检测在软件工程和系统验证领域变得尤为重要。为了帮助学习者掌握这方面的核心技术,我强烈推荐Coursera上的《Automated Reasoning: Symbolic Model Checking》课程。这门课程由基础到深入,系统介绍了如何自动验证系统和程序的性质,特别是通过符号模型检测技术。课程内容涵盖了转移系统的基本概念,CTL(计算树逻辑)表达性质的方法,以及利用BDDs(二叉决策图)进行符号表示,显著提升了处理大规模状态空间的能力。课程结构合理,从模型检测的基础知识出发,逐步引入BDDs的原理与应用,最后结合实例演示了符号模型检测在实际中的应用效果。无论你是系统工程师、软件开发者还是研究人员,掌握这门课程都将极大丰富你的专业技能,助力你在自动化验证的道路上迈出坚实的一步。

    课程链接: https://www.coursera.org/learn/automated-reasoning-symbolic-model-checking

  • 深入学习《定量形式建模与最坏性能分析》课程推荐

    课程链接: https://www.coursera.org/learn/quantitative-formal-modeling-1

    近年来,嵌入式系统和理论计算机科学的交叉研究日益受到关注。Coursera平台上的《定量形式建模与最坏性能分析》课程正是为这些领域的学习者量身打造的优质课程。该课程由浅入深,系统讲解了系统行为的抽象建模,特别是令许多研究者和工程师受益匪浅的令牌产生与消耗模型。课程内容涵盖了从基础的模型绘制、形式化语法到Petri网的实际应用,再到复杂性能指标的性能分析,为学员提供了理论与实践结合的完美示范。

    课程特色在于引入前缀序和计数函数的数学框架,使抽象思维能力得以提升。通过学习Petri网的限制条件,学员可以在不依赖实际模型的情况下,证明系统的各种性能性质。此外,课程还深入讲解了如何利用单速数据流图进行最坏情况性能分析,包括最大循环平均值、调度优化及缓冲区大小的确定。这些内容对于嵌入式系统设计和性能优化具有极高的应用价值。

    课程的教学方式丰富多样,结合了讲解、示例、作业以及同行评议,促进学员自主学习与合作交流。无论你是计算机科学、嵌入式系统或者自动控制的研究者,这门课都能为你的专业技能提供极大的帮助。强烈推荐给希望提升系统建模和性能分析能力的同学们!

    课程链接: https://www.coursera.org/learn/quantitative-formal-modeling-1

  • 深入学习系统验证:Coursera课程《System Validation (3): Requirements by modal formulas》推荐与评测

    课程链接: https://www.coursera.org/learn/system-validation-modal-formulas

    在现代系统开发中,确保系统行为的正确性至关重要。Coursera上的《System Validation (3): Requirements by modal formulas》课程,为我们提供了系统验证的前沿技术与方法。课程内容丰富,涵盖基础和高级模态逻辑公式,帮助学员掌握用形式化方法描述和验证系统行为的能力。无论是确保无死锁,还是实现复杂的行为保证,课程都提供了理论支撑与实用技巧。

    课程通过详细的讲解和实际案例,介绍了Hennessy-Milner逻辑及其扩展,使学习者能够用逻辑语言精确描述系统需求。特别是关于数据使用、公平性属性以及参数化布尔方程系统的部分,让我对系统验证的深度和广度有了更全面的理解。

    我强烈推荐对自动化验证、嵌入式系统设计或软件工程感兴趣的学习者参加这个课程。它不仅能提升你的验证技能,还能帮助你在实际项目中设计出结构合理、无误差的系统,确保系统安全、高效运行。

    课程链接: https://www.coursera.org/learn/system-validation-modal-formulas

  • 深入学习《定量形式建模与最坏情况性能分析》:提升系统分析能力的优质课程

    课程链接: https://www.coursera.org/learn/quantitative-formal-modeling-1

    近年来,随着嵌入式系统和复杂系统的发展,系统性能分析变得尤为重要。Coursera上的《定量形式建模与最坏情况性能分析》课程为学习者提供了一个理论与实践相结合的学习平台,帮助大家掌握从抽象模型到性能优化的完整技能。课程内容丰富,从基础的令牌生产与消费模型开始,逐步引导学员理解前缀序、计数函数以及Petri网的应用。特别适合对理论计算机科学、嵌入式系统以及性能分析感兴趣的学生和工程师。课程不仅强调抽象思维训练,还配备了丰富的实操任务,让学员在实践中巩固知识。无论你是初学者还是有一定基础的专业人士,都能从中获益匪浅。建议对系统建模、性能分析或者Petri网感兴趣的你,千万不要错过这门课程,开启你的系统分析之旅!

    课程链接: https://www.coursera.org/learn/quantitative-formal-modeling-1